The Police Station Building Committee began their work in the first meeting on Wednesday, August 23, 2023. First step getting sworn in by Town Clerk Nancy Danello was quickly accomplished.
Round of introductions by the members of the committee was conducted.
Town Administrator Jamie Hellen provided a brief overview. Facilities Director Mike D'Angelo walked through the overall process they will get into.
High level process (additional detail in memo)
- Request for a Proposal (RFP) for an Owner Project Manager (OPM)
- Select an OPM
- Work with the OPM to select an architect
- Site visits to current station (what is) and other community stations (what could be)
- Schematic design
- Design development
- Construction documents
- Bidding
- Construction
The site and site selection are important as is the funding and approval for such. While the actual building process was talk of being done in about 2 years, the entire process is more likely to run 3-5 years.
